Product Description:

The MHD093B-035-PG1-LA is a servo motor produced by Bosch Rexroth Indramat and supplied as part of the MHD Synchronous Motors series. Integrated feedback and a low-inertia rotor allow the unit to work with drive controllers for position and velocity control on CNC machines, printing lines, and material-handling axes. By generating commanded torque directly at the load, the motor supports accurate cycle response and helps reduce wear in belts, couplings, and other transmission components. Its general design suits automated equipment that requires repeatable motion over frequent start-stop cycles.

It develops a continuous standstill torque of 17.5 Nm, allowing the shaft to hold loads without motion while energized. The enclosure is rated IP65, so dust and water jets are kept away from internal windings and bearings. Rotor position is reported through digital servo feedback from an integrated optical encoder, which allows the connected drive to maintain stable commutation and accurate position control through repeated cycles. Safe operation is maintained within an ambient range of 0 to 40 °C, and output must be derated outside that range. A 130 mm centering diameter supports precise mounting, while the 140 / 150 mm flange, plain shaft, and left-side power connector simplify installation and cable routing.

A holding brake produces 22.0 Nm of locking torque when control power is removed, which helps prevent back-driving on vertical axes. Cooling relies on natural convection, venting heat through the aluminum housing without fans and keeping the motor suitable for enclosed machine layouts. Closed-loop precision benefits from a system accuracy of ± 0.5 angular minutes, and Class F insulation increases thermal endurance to 155 °C. A shaft seal limits ingress during washdown procedures. Storage is permitted from -20 to +80 °C, installation is allowed up to 1000 m above sea level, the B length code indicates the motor depth, motor size 093 matches the frame, and winding code 035 is intended for the corresponding drive combination.
